Fluidics Engineer

– Sleepy Hollow, NY – $55-$60 hourly – 12+ month contract

Our client is currently seeking a Fluidics Engineer for a 12 month + contract.

Summary Lead the development and implementation of advanced fluidic sub-systems for cutting-edge medical devices. This critical role requires a subject matter expert to independently drive and complete complex mechanical and fluidic designs from concept through production. You will utilize your expertise across all engineering phases, including CAD, prototyping, testing, and cross-functional production release.

Responsibilities

Lead and complete conceptualized design solutions for mechanical and fluidics systems, meeting critical requirements and timelines

Complete detailed engineering analysis of new and existing designs to verify robustness and design intent, with little or no oversight

Produce and approve detailed drawings utilizing GD&T and engineering best practices

Drive large complex engineering changes through the Siemens design change and release process

Lead and complete complex root cause analysis investigations

Prepare prototypes for testing and provide technical assistance on design feasibility

Collaborate with external vendors and suppliers to resolve technical design and manufacturing issues, ensuring quality and manufacturability

Work closely with manufacturing and field service in the development of designs

Conduct and approve prototype testing and laboratory best practices

Lead and complete drafting and design reviews with a cross functional team

Perform all verification activities and document results for knowledge transfer

Embrace simulation culture in all work activities, conducting or directing work in the discipline

Plan and forecast large work scopes within and outside of cross functional team

Train and mentor less experienced engineers

Direct activities of other engineers, lab technicians, etc

Knowledge, Skills, Education and Experience

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ering (advanced degrees a plus)

8-10+ years of industry experience in product design and development

Experience with product development in an FDA regulated environment. Willing to consider other regulated industries.

Extensive design experience with fluidic hardware, including pumps, valves, manifold design, and flow/pressure sensors.

Strong foundation in the first principles of fluid mechanics, including the governing equations, and solid grasp of practical concepts like laminar flow, turbulent flow, pressure drop, and viscous effects.

Proficiency with 3D CAD (preferably NX) to develop designs utilizing proper design intent

Proficiency with PLM systems (preferably Teamcenter) and workflows

Proficient with Microsoft Office Applications (Word, PowerPoint, Excel, and Outlook)

Strong proficiency with GD&T best practices and ability to perform complex tolerance stackups

Demonstrated ability to accurately forecast, plan, and manage large work scopes using project management best practices and Agile frameworks (Scrum)

FEA or CFD simulation skills or close working relationships needed

Successfully conducted complex troubleshooting and root cause investigations

Strong experience with manufacturing methods including machined, sheet metal, castings and plastic injection molding

Strong written and oral communication skills
